· Michael Faraday's electric magnetic rotation apparatus (motor) The first surviving Faraday apparatus, dating from 1822, which demonstrates his work in magnetic rotation. Faraday used this mercury bath to transform electrical energy into mechanical energy, creating the first electric motor.

Magnetic moment. The concept of magnetic moment is the starting point when discussing the behaviour of magnetic materials within a field. If you place a bar magnet in a field then it will experience a torque or moment tending to align its axis in the direction of the field. A compass needle behaves the same.

· Magnetic separation in kaolin processing is a comparatively low cost and versatile technique. By variation of retention time, it is possible to achieve differing degrees of magnetic extraction at acceptable variations in costs. The HEMF process is not only low in operating cost, but also furnishes high yield 9899% of kaolin product based on feed.
